Как изменить имя схемы в Crystal report 11? - PullRequest
2 голосов
/ 05 августа 2009

Отчет разрабатывается в Crystal Reports XI.

Используется ODBC-соединение с базой данных Oracle с использованием CR-ODBC-драйвера 4.1.

Мне нужно, чтобы этот отчет был легко распределен по 14 сайтам, использующим тот же DSN ODBC, но база данных на каждом сайте имеет своего владельца и / или имя схемы.

Я следовал инструкциям Business Objects, чтобы изменить полное имя для каждой таблицы в отчете:

  1. В меню «База данных» выберите «Установить местоположение источника данных». Откроется диалоговое окно «Установить местоположение источника данных».

  2. В области «Текущий источник данных» разверните список текущих подключений, чтобы просмотреть каждую таблицу в отчете.

  3. Для каждой таблицы в отчете:

    я. Разверните список «Свойства».

    * * 1 022 II. Нажмите «Переопределить имя квалифицированной таблицы», а затем нажмите клавишу F2 или дважды щелкните.

    III. Переместите курсор в конец текста и введите имя таблицы.

    IV. Нажмите Enter.

Я получаю ошибку

Crystal Reports

Не удалось получить данные из базы данных.

Подробности: ORA-00942: таблица или представление не существует

[Код поставщика базы данных: 942]

Мне нужно исправить эти ошибки или найти лучший способ сделать эти отчеты Oracle более переносимыми.

...